ORDINANCE NO. ..sf6
A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F SEAL BEACH
CREA TING THE POSITION OF DffiECTOR OF
FINANCE, DEFINING THE POWERS AND DUTffiS
THEREOF AND TRANSFERRING THE SAME
FROM THE CITY CLERK.

The CUy Council of the CUy of Seal Beach does ordain as follows:
SECTION l: Pursuant to the provisions of Section 40805. 5 of the
8
Government Code of the State of CaLifornia there is hereby created and
established the office of the Director of Finance of the CUy of Seal Beach.
SECTION 2: The financial and accounting duties imposed upon the
City Clerk by Sections 40802 to 40805 inclusive, of the Government Code
of the State of California, are hereby transferred to the Director of
Finance. He shall perform the following duties:
l. Maintenance of Financial Records: Maintain all records readily
reflecting the financial condUion of the CUy and all of Us Departments;
2. Report for Fiscal Year: At the end of each fiscal year, prepare
and present to the CUy Council a summary statement of receipts and
disbursements by departments and funds, including opening and closing fund
balances in the CUy treasury;
3. Publication of Financial Statement: Cause the financial statement
of the City to be published in accordance with the provisions of
Sections 40804 and 40805 of the Government Code;
4. Compilation of Financial Information for Budget: Compile all
financial information necessary for the preparation of the Cityts budget
and make such information available to the officer whose responsibility
it is to prepare the budget;
5. Monthly Financial Report: Prepare a monthly statement of all
receipts and disbursements in suffl,cient detail to show the financial
condition of the City and tlach of Us Departments;
30 6. Licenses: Supervise and be in charge of license issuance and
31 inspectionl
32 7. Payroll Records: Supervise and be in charge of all payroll records;

1 8. Insurance Policies: Maintain a record of aU insurance policies
2 and their expiration dates;
3
4
5
6
7
9. Collection of Taxes, Assessments, etc.: See that aU taxes,
assessments and other fees and revenues of the City, or for whose
coUection the City is responsible, and aU other money receivable by the
City from the County, State, or federal government, or from any court,
office, department or agency of the City are collected; and perform such
other duties that are from time to time assigned to him by the C.Uy CounciL.
SECTION 3: Pursuant to the requirements of the laws of the State
wUh reference thereto (Section 37209 of the Government Code), the
Director of Finance, before entering upon the duties of his office, shaU
execute a bond in the amount to be determined by the City Council.
SECTION 4: The CUy Clerk shall certify to the passage and adoption
of this ordinance by the CUy Council of Seal Beach and cause the same
to be published once in the "Seal Beach Post and Wave", a newspaper
of general circulation, published and circulated in the City of Seal Beach.
PASSED, APPROVED AND ADOPTED by the City Council of the
City of Seal Beach at a regular meeting of the City Council held on the
2lst day of June, 1960.
